Mata Puteh Birds Singing Competition @ Serangoon North



A Tour @ Mata Puteh Birds Singing Competition

On this day 30th March 2014, it was my pleasure to have a chance with Mr Heng (The Organizer - of Serangoon North Mata Putehs competition). He was already there when I reached around 8 am, he and his team mates were sitting at a round table administrating the participants and those last minute registration. As this was the 1st  time we met, I just introduced myself and sat beside them watching them busying with the event. 

Upon Registration


Participants submitted their tickets and allocate their birds “Hanger” slots to standby for the competition once the judges arrive. The ticket also entitles them for a Lucky Draw whereby prizes like LCD TV and many other items to be won.

 




Start Of Competition

 At around 9.30 am, the judges announces the competition start and everyone begin to remove the cover cloths from their birds. Meanwhile the 3 judges started judging the birds for 3 rounds and a final round of 30 birds will compete again but this final round will be judge by different judges.

Judgments will base on the following: Loudness – Stamina – Varieties etc.

After each round of competition, the score sheets will be consolidate by the admin team and result will be posted on the wall for contestants to check how many points their birds score for each round. The final 30 best performers will get to the final round that warrant them a trophy.


End Of Competition

At around 1 pm, all participants will gather at the community centre for the trophies presentation and of cause the lucky draw prizes as well.

Preparing your Puteh for contest

Preparing your Puteh for contest

As we learn together, Puteh birds colonies living in a socially huddle. Generally, a Puteh when alone will simply skip here and there inside a cage when seeing another Puteh around him. When in the middle of a crowd of other birds, Puteh twitter and singing his best songs to be able to articulately connect with others is very important factor. There are a couple of tips to keep twittering birds, loud Puteh from start to finish in a contest.

1. Puteh bird on the condition that the level of sexual arousal and primes are normal. Being diligent bird Puteh Twitter caused by stimulation of the estrous cycle is affected by hormones testosterone, the hormone estrogen and progesterone hormones that are present in the body. These hormones are formed as a result of external stimuli rapidly (Sunbath: infrared rays) and high protein levels in food consumption. Birds should be sexual arousal, but Puteh is not too sexual arousal (over estrous cycle). Need to "trial and error" to be able to find the desired level of sexual arousal as a bird character Puteh at our disposal. Generally in 2-3 days before the contest day, birds have started to undergo ritual Puteh adjust estrous cycle with the addition of the option is accumulative Psychology culture.

2. Get to know the characters. This is the most important factor for being able to understand and train a Puteh. Puteh have the social life of a huddle, twittering and chanting songs sonorous is one way for birds to attract the opposite sex and give information to other birds on the boundaries of the territory.

3. We can split birds into 3 parts, namely:
a) Song (long booms with the strains of a dulcet tone to show off his ability and attracted the attention of the opposite sex).
b) Call (loud, short call for feedback of the opposite sex)
c) Alert (Twitter and similar sound to warn birds and bird companion when there is danger. Twitter also serves as a marker of the territorial area of other birds).

Each Puteh’s character is different; there are no bird Puteh exactly the same. Share research results and with friends who are lovers Puteh Indonesia and some neighboring countries, can be summed up as follows:

There are a few birds to Puteh full isolation for 7-10 days prior to the contest. During the ritual, the isolation of birds does not see and hear other Puteh birds sing. The days of isolation still undergoing daily treatment patterns, Puteh birds will chirp out loud “Toa Aw” regardless of the length of the birds Puteh around him at the time of the contest along with other contestants.

There are some Puteh formerly paired together couples, placed both Putehs in a cage during the ritual for 7-10 days prior to the contest. At the time of the contest with other contestants, Puteh birds will chirp out long loud “Toa Aw” for females regardless of Puteh birds around him.

This is also a factor that must be considered. Without good nutrition, it will be difficult to make the bird perform. There are some birds that do not need ritual Puteh isolation and ritual female companion. Treat them on daily care, just add nutritional to support on stamina until the day of the contest. At the time of the contest along with other contestants, Puteh birds will chirp out loud “Toa Aw” regardless of the length of the birds Puteh around him at the time of the contest along with other contestants.

Tips Choosing Male Puteh Bird Guides

These are some pointers which I look out when choosing:

a) Look for those with slim and long body, no deformed feet etc.
b) Make sure those do not have any bad habits like head rotation or even somersault.
c) Look out for middle tone. If one does, confirm male. This type of birds can normally choose already.
A good bird combines all these, the length/pitch of buka really depends on luck and the duration which you rear the bird and how you take care of it. Let me quote an example. If the bird which you have chosen has very good genes, the dad may be a champion bird. If you feed it with the wrong food, don't bath it regularly, or even keep the bird in the wrong location in your house when it can get quite warm in the day time, then it starts to drink more water and develops water droppings etc…

Tips Choosing Male Puteh Bird Guides

1. Birds moving agile and aggressive.
2. The birds are not defective.
3. Body Postures and are proportionate in length.
4. Dry Fur, neat but not dull and symmetrical clamp wings
5. Larger Broad Head with long neck.
6. The base of the beak is thick, long and wide; half the width of the base of the beak is aligned with.
7. Feet dry with strong gripping at standing.
8. Call Tones out loud and sonorous, the thickness of Puteh’s spectacles in times of molting, the glasses will thin out, Puteh bird’s tail shaped forms either V or flat.

Puteh Tails Feathers

Puteh Tails (FanTail)


Nowadays it is very rare to see a Fantail Puteh...

A bird's tail consists of a tailbone, a set of flight feathers, and a layer of covering feathers at the base of the tail. The tail serves a number of aerodynamic functions.

The number the tail feathers by counting outward both right and left from the central most pair of tail feathers. For instance, both the right central tail feather is number one and the left central feather is number one. We count outward to the outer right and left tail feather respectively. For example, the outer right and left tail feather of most songbirds is number six, meaning that songbirds typically have six pairs of tail feathers.

Without their tail feathers, flying would be a pretty difficult chore. It acts as a rudder to provide stability and control steering of direction of a bird’s flight, and it also helps the bird land, take off, and change altitude. When not flying, many birds use their tail feathers as supports when on the ground or climbing the sides of trees.

Gather some fruits for Puteh Birds

Fruits are an integral part in food for Puteh, it replenishing the nutrients for the birds. Even wild birds are also often looking for fruits to eat. The following are some fruits that Puteh enjoyed.
Puteh hobbyist knows of any other fruits, please add-on, looking forward for suggestions to share and improve.



This is my personal opinion, taken from reality whom have been feeding Puteh birds. These fruits would not do any harm to Puteh bird. 


Gather some fruits for Puteh Birds

Apples/Bananas/Papayas: Dry and not dirtying the cage, very suitable for birds.

Oranges: During hot weather, cooling for birds, especially to detoxify.

Cooling effects

Cucumber/Luffa/ water chestnut/: Helping Puteh to grow excellent conditioned silky plumage (Especially during molting). 


Tomatoes/Carrot: Help the Puteh build up brilliant beautiful colours.
